Aging: 18 months in French oak barrels and six months in the bottle.
Color: Dark violet-red with good intensity.
Aroma: Complex aromas of ripe red fruits, with notes of black pepper and chocolate, beautifully integrated with the oak.
Palate: Balanced, rich, and full-bodied, with ripe, silky tannins. Long and persistent finish.
Food pairing: Red meats and aged cheeses.
Origin: Grapes from the Palquibudis area (Fundo Chile Chico), nestled between the mountain ranges of the Curicó Valley.
Variety: Malbec, Carmenère, and Cabernet Sauvignon.
Service: 16° to 18° C
